Public bug reported:

Ubuntu 10.04.3 LTS
mountall version: 2.15.3

During the routine disk check when booting the system, the message for
the user begins:

"Your disk drives are being checked for errors, this may take some time
Checking disc 1 of 1"

The first line uses "disk" but the second uses "disc". This is
inconsistent. One spelling should be used in both instances. I suggest
the "disk" spelling for both, since "disc" usually seems to refer to
optical media.
